Wide-Body Airliner Product
Overview
A wide-body airliner is the largest mass-produced machine humans build. Airbus quotes about four million individual parts in an A380, manufactured by roughly 1,500 companies in 30 countries; Boeing's 747 carried a similar six-million-part legend for half a century. Most of those parts are not exotic — they are rivets, lockbolts, clips and brackets, repeated hundreds of thousands of times across the Fuselage Sections and Wings that carry everything else.
The airframe divides into five large Fuselage Sections joined at circumferential splices, two Wings built around three-spar boxes, and a composite Empennage. Each fuselage section alone carries hundreds of frames and stringers and over 400,000 Rivet / Lockbolts; each wing adds another 660,000 fasteners through its Wing Spars, Wing Ribs and machined Wing Skin Panels.
Propulsion
Thrust comes from up to four Large Turbofan Engines, each a roughly 25,000-part machine in its own right. Air enters through the Fan Module — two dozen Fan Blades on a single Fan Disc inside a containment Fan Containment Case — then passes the fourteen stages of the Compressor Module, burns in the Combustor's Fuel Nozzle spray, and expands through the Turbine Module, whose Turbine Blade Rows run single-crystal Turbine Blades cooled below the gas temperature around them. The Engine Hardware Set set — seals, vanes, tubes and 22,000 fasteners — is what takes each engine to its documented part count.
Systems
The Electrical & Wiring System is the clearest window into the scale: about 530 kilometres of cable in ~100,000 individual Wire Run runs, terminated by ~40,300 Connectors — figures Airbus publishes for the A380. Four engine-driven Engine Generators feed twelve Power Distribution Panels. Flight control runs through the Hydraulic System's dual 5,000 psi circuits — eight Hydraulic Pumps, forty Flight Control Actuators and over a thousand titanium Hydraulic Line Segment segments — while the Fuel System manages up to 320,000 litres across its tanks with twenty-one Fuel Pumps and a hundred gauging Fuel Quantity Probes.
The Avionics Suite concentrates computing into IMA Cabinets — integrated modular avionics racks that replaced dozens of federated boxes — driving ten Flight Displays and triple-redundant ADIRS Unit and Flight Guidance Computer channels.
Cabin
The Cabin Interior is a building interior flying at Mach 0.85: up to 550 Passenger Seats (each itself ~150 parts of frame, cushions and recline mechanisms), eight Galley Monuments, fourteen Lavatory Module modules, 120 Overhead Bins and some 900 Cabin Lining Panels, plus a seat-back IFE Display for every passenger.
Landing gear
The Landing Gear Set set puts up to 22 wheels on the ground: a steerable Nose Gear and four Main Gear Bogies whose Carbon Brake Packs absorb the energy of 400 tonnes arriving at 250 km/h.
